use rb_pid_t instead of pid_t.
* process.c (rb_execarg_addopt, run_exec_pgroup): use rb_pid_t instead of pid_t. * ext/pty/pty.c (raise_from_check, pty_check): ditto. git-svn-id: svn+ssh:// b2dd03c8-39d4-4d8f-98ff-823fe69b080e
@@ -604,9 +604,9 @@ pty_getpty(int argc, VALUE *argv, VALUE self)
return res;
-NORETURN(static void raise_from_check(pid_t pid, int status));
+NORETURN(static void raise_from_check(rb_pid_t pid, int status));
static void
-raise_from_check(pid_t pid, int status)
+raise_from_check(rb_pid_t pid, int status)
const char *state;
char buf[1024];
@@ -654,7 +654,7 @@ static VALUE
pty_check(int argc, VALUE *argv, VALUE self)
VALUE pid, exc;
- pid_t cpid;
+ rb_pid_t cpid;
int status;
rb_scan_args(argc, argv, "11", &pid, &exc);